Property Market in Yarm and TS15 0

The Yarm property market in TS15 0 has shown resilience despite broader national fluctuations, with recent Land Registry data indicating average sold prices in the area reaching approximately £285,000 for standard residential properties. Year-on-year analysis reveals modest growth of around 2-3% in most sectors, with the TS15 0 postcode maintaining its appeal as a commuter town with strong local amenities. The town centre around the High Street and Stonebridge area commands premium prices, particularly for period properties and homes within the conservation zone.

Postcode sector analysis shows interesting variations within TS15 0, with properties near the River Tees and the prestigious Yarm School catchment area commanding premium valuations. The average time to sell in this market sits at approximately 8-10 weeks for correctly priced properties, though well-presented homes in popular streets like West Street, High Street, and the avenues surrounding the town centre can achieve sales within 4-6 weeks. Our data indicates that properties priced competitively within the first week of marketing typically achieve within 5% of their asking price, highlighting the importance of accurate initial pricing.

The mix of housing stock in TS15 0 contributes significantly to market dynamics, with Victorian and Edwardian terraces dominating the town centre while newer developments provide modern alternatives. Detached properties in the surrounding areas command substantial premiums, with four and five-bedroom homes regularly exceeding £400,000. First-time buyers are well-served by the flat and terraced stock available, typically purchasing properties in the £150,000-£220,000 range. The variety of property types means different agents may have particular strengths depending on what you're selling.

Area Character and Local Insight

Yarm sits on the north bank of the River Tees in the borough of Stockton-on-Tees, offering a distinctive blend of market town heritage and modern convenience. The town centre features a conservation area spanning much of the High Street, with listed buildings housing independent shops, cafes, and traditional pubs. The geology of the area consists largely of Permian sandstone bedrock, with the Tees valley floor featuring more recent alluvial deposits, characteristics that local surveyors understand when assessing property foundations and potential flooding risks.

Demographically, Yarm attracts a mix of families drawn by the highly regarded Yarm School (one of the largest independent schools in the North of England), young professionals commuting to Teesside or further afield via the railway station, and retirees seeking the town's amenities and accessibility. The population skews towards families with children, contributing to strong local demand for family housing and contributing to the premium achieved in the school catchment area. Transport links include Yarm railway station providing regular services to Middlesbrough, Darlington, and York, while the A19 trunk road offers straightforward road connections to the wider region.

Flood risk in TS15 0 is considered low for most properties, though homes near the River Tees floodplain have historically required flood resilience measures. The Environment Agency maps show the majority of the town centre and residential areas outside the riverside walk fall outside significant flood zones. Local amenities include the high street shopping, Yarm Golf Club, and various parks and recreational areas, making it a self-sufficient town that doesn't require travel to larger centres for everyday needs. The combination of these factors makes Yarm particularly attractive to families and commuters alike, driving consistent demand for properties in the area.

Online vs High-Street Agents in TS15 0

Sellers in the TS15 0 area have access to both traditional high-street estate agents and online alternatives, each offering distinct advantages depending on your priorities. Traditional agents operating in Yarm typically charge percentage-based fees averaging 1.5% plus VAT, providing dedicated office presence, local market expertise, and face-to-face valuation services. The town's traditional agent presence includes established names with physical offices in the town centre who understand the nuances of the Yarm market, including the impact of the conservation area on property values.

Online estate agents have gained traction among TS15 0 sellers seeking lower upfront costs, with fixed fee models typically ranging from £999 to £1,500. These services work particularly well for straightforward property sales where the vendor is comfortable handling some aspects of the process digitally. However, the complexity of the Yarm market, with its period properties and conservation considerations, often benefits from the hands-on approach that high-street agents provide, particularly when negotiating with buyers who may be unfamiliar with the area. Our experience shows that local knowledge can be particularly valuable in markets like Yarm where property characteristics vary significantly between streets.

Multi-agency agreements remain an option for sellers seeking maximum exposure, typically involving a higher total fee (usually an additional 0.5-1% if sold through the second agent) but providing coverage across multiple agency databases. Most agents in the TS15 0 area work on sole agency terms of 8-16 weeks, though the average sale time in Yarm means many instructions run to their full term. Getting valuations from multiple agents before instructing allows sellers to compare marketing approaches, fee structures, and their understanding of the local market. We recommend taking advantage of the free valuation services offered by multiple agents to make an informed decision.

How to Choose the Right Estate Agent in TS15 0

1

Research Local Agents

Start by identifying all estate agents actively marketing properties in TS15 0. Look at their current listings in the Yarm area, their experience with properties similar to yours, and client reviews. Pay attention to whether they have listings in your specific part of TS15 0, as local knowledge matters.

2

Get Multiple Valuations

Request free valuations from at least three different agents. Compare their suggested asking prices and ask them to explain their methodology. Be wary of agents who suggest unrealistically high prices to win your business, as overpricing typically leads to longer marketing times and eventual price reductions.

3

Compare Marketing Strategies

Ask about each agent's marketing plan for your property, including their online presence, photography quality, and portal coverage. In the digital age, strong online marketing is essential, but don't underestimate the value of quality photography and well-written descriptions that highlight your property's unique features.

4

Check Fee Structures

Understand whether agents charge fixed fees or percentage-based commissions, and clarify what is included in their fee. Remember that the cheapest option isn't always the best value - an agent who achieves a higher sale price may leave you better off despite charging more. Ask for a detailed breakdown of what's included.

5

Review Contract Terms

Understand the sole or multi-agency terms, contract duration, and termination clauses before signing any agreement. Most contracts in the TS15 0 area run for 8-16 weeks. Ensure you understand what happens if you want to terminate early or if your property doesn't sell within the initial term.

6

Negotiate Terms

Don't accept the first offer - negotiate fees, contract length, and terms to get the best possible deal. Many agents have flexibility in their fees, especially in competitive situations. Get everything in writing and ensure you fully understand the terms before signing.

Getting the Best Price for Your TS15 0 Property

Achieving the best price for your TS15 0 property starts with accurate initial pricing based on current market conditions and recent comparable sales. Overpricing in the Yarm market typically results in extended marketing periods, with properties eventually requiring price reductions that can achieve less than if correctly priced from the start. The most successful sales in this market involve properties presented to their full potential with professional photography and accurate, detailed descriptions that highlight period features or modern upgrades.

Agent fees in TS15 0 typically range from 1% to 3% plus VAT, with the average around 1.5% (1.8% including VAT) for traditional high-street agents. These fees are negotiable, and many agents will offer discounted rates for competitive situations or bundled services including professional photography, floorplans, and marketing materials. Remember that the cheapest agent is rarely the best value - an agent who achieves a higher sale price despite charging more will leave you better off overall. Getting everything in writing, including exactly what services are included and any optional extras, protects you from unexpected costs later.

Our team has observed that agents who provide detailed market reports, including comparable properties and analysis of current competition, tend to achieve better results for their clients. During the sale process, regular communication and proactive marketing make a significant difference. When choosing your agent, ask how they will keep you updated, how they plan to market your specific property, and what their typical time-on-market figures are for properties similar to yours in the TS15 0 area.

How much do estate agents charge in TS15 0?

Estate agent fees in TS15 0 typically range from 1% to 3% plus VAT, with most traditional agents charging around 1.5% (1.8% including VAT) of the sale price. For a property valued at £285,000 (the average in the area), this would equate to approximately £4,275 including VAT. Online fixed-fee agents offer alternatives starting from around £999 to £1,500, though these may lack the local presence and hands-on service that the Yarm market often benefits from. Always clarify exactly what services are included in any quoted fee, as some agents offer more comprehensive marketing packages than others.

Do I need a survey when selling in TS15 0?

While not legally required to market your property, having a survey available can actually speed up the sale process in TS15 0. Buyers appreciate transparency about property condition, and a current survey can strengthen your position during negotiations. An RICS Level 2 survey (HomeReport in Scotland) is typically sufficient for standard properties, while larger or older homes may benefit from a more detailed RICS Level 3 building survey. Many sellers in the area opt for a survey before marketing to identify and address any issues proactively, particularly given the number of period properties in Yarm which may have older features requiring specialist assessment.
